有关JNDI查找地问题

04-04-03 wy123456789
我们在作EJB是,经常要用到JNDI查找Home接口,我在一些书上看到地方法是:在需要地时候重新建立一个Context进行查找。我想能不能写一个工具方法,只用一个Context查呢,这样减少了构造Context地时间

还可以把找到地Home对象缓存起来,这样可以提高效率呀。

不知想法对不对????

banq
2004-04-05 14:43
非常正确,Service Locator模式就是这样做的。

相关可参考:

1. J2EE核心模式

2. http://www.martinfowler.com/articles/injection.html

3. 代码可见SUN的petstore Servicelocator代码。

猜你喜欢